Block

#18,373,613
Block Number
18,373,613 @ 2024-04-28 08:26:00
Status
Finalized
ID
0x01185bed1cbda94c5b6ba809805d961e879dc3957db5b9146490503e4fa871b1
Transactions
Gas Used
32786678/38958493 (84.16% Used)
Total Score
1,790,945,739 (+97)
Rewards
98.36 VTHO